Boilermakers play a critical role in various industries, constructing and repairing boilers, tanks, and other large vessels. The nature of their work involves exposure to high temperatures, heavy materials, and potentially hazardous environments. Ensuring the wellbeing of boilermakers not only protects them from harm but also contributes to the efficiency and success of the projects they work on.
The hazards of boilermaker work
- Working with welding torches and in high-temperature environments poses significant risks of burns and fire-related injuries.
- Boilermakers frequently handle heavy metal components, which can lead to musculoskeletal injuries if proper lifting techniques are not followed.
- Boilers and tanks are often enclosed, creating potential risks for suffocation, inhalation of toxic fumes, and limited mobility in emergencies.
- Working at heights or on elevated platforms increases the risk of falls, especially when handling heavy tools and materials.
Key safety practices for boilermakers
Personal Protective Equipment (PPE)
Wearing the appropriate PPE is non-negotiable in boilermaker work. This includes:
- Welding helmets with appropriate filters to protect against sparks and intense light.
- Flame-resistant clothing to minimise the risk of burns.
- Heat-resistant gloves to handle hot materials safely.
- Respirators when working in environments with poor ventilation or exposure to hazardous fumes.
- Safety harnesses when working at heights to prevent falls.
Proper training and certification
Boilermakers should undergo comprehensive training that covers all aspects of their work, from welding techniques to safety protocols. Certification ensures that workers are knowledgeable about the latest safety standards and best practices.
Safe work environment
Before starting any job, the work area should be thoroughly inspected. This includes ensuring proper ventilation in confined spaces, checking for flammable materials, and verifying that all equipment is in good working condition.
Correct handling of tools and equipment
Boilermakers must be proficient in the use of their tools and equipment. This includes understanding the proper handling, maintenance, and storage of welding torches, grinders, and heavy machinery. Regular equipment checks and maintenance are essential to prevent malfunctions that could lead to accidents.
Safe lifting techniques
Heavy lifting is a common part of a boilermaker’s job. To avoid injuries, it is crucial to use safe lifting techniques, such as bending at the knees, keeping the back straight, and seeking assistance or using mechanical aids when lifting particularly heavy objects.
Emergency preparedness
Boilermakers should be trained in emergency response procedures, including how to safely evacuate confined spaces, provide first aid, and handle fire or explosion incidents. Having a clear understanding of the site’s emergency protocols can make a significant difference in preventing injuries or fatalities.
